The silly Lumia 950 from 2015 still has specifications that have only started being beat in the last year. They had stuff like the first 4K video (2013) - first HDR, first 5.1 sound encoding, etc. The OS was also faster than Android and iOS, was insanely stable, and had a multi-layer isolation App model designed into the OS, meaning it was really secure. UK House of Lords calls for loot boxes to be considered gambling
matthiew reacted to StrikedOut for a topic
Lootboxes are usually purchased with real money. As are packets of football cards/stickers and pokemon cards. Super interesting point. If you breakdown both down to fundamentals (i.e. buying an item which has a chance involved of what's returned) then it seems like both are forms of gambling. It may be that because loot boxes are in the news more often, it's the one that's being scrutinised. I guess the only difference I can think of is that you can take your cards and swap with friends, you cant in game with loot boxes. Perhaps trading cards need to be looked at as well? Either way, loot boxes need to be scrutinised. I play World of Tanks and each Christmas, I buy some loot boxes but as a sensible adult, I accept that I may not get what I am after and spend well within my means but there are plenty of games aimed at kids with loot boxes.1 point -
